Collection and Analysis of Evidence

Collection and analysis of evidence are fundamental components in establishing the facts of a pedestrian accident. Accident reconstruction experts diligently gather all relevant physical and documentary evidence at the scene, including vehicle debris, skid marks, footprints, and surveillance footage. They also record environmental conditions such as lighting, weather, and traffic signals that could influence the crash’s circumstances.

Experts then analyze this evidence systematically to determine the sequence of events. They measure skid distances, analyze vehicle damage patterns, and assess pedestrian injuries to understand how the accident occurred. This comprehensive analysis helps produce an accurate reconstruction of the incident, which is critical in pedestrian accident claims to establish fault and liability.

Accurate collection and analysis of evidence ensure that all relevant factors are considered, providing a clear picture of the accident. This process supports legal teams by presenting fact-based findings, vital in court proceedings and in negotiating fair settlements.

Techniques and Tools Used by Accident Reconstruction Experts

Accident reconstruction experts employ a variety of sophisticated techniques and tools to analyze pedestrian accidents meticulously. They often begin with detailed scene documentation, including sketches, photographs, and video recordings, to preserve the accident environment accurately. This visual evidence forms the foundation for subsequent analysis.

Specialized software programs are frequently used to create 3D models of the accident scene, helping reconstruct the vehicle’s and pedestrian’s trajectories precisely. These tools enable experts to simulate different scenarios and assess how various factors contributed to the collision. Additionally, measuring devices such as laser scanners and total stations provide precise data on distances and angles at the scene.

Experts also analyze physical evidence like skid marks, debris, and vehicle damage. These details, combined with vehicle telemetry data and witness statements, allow for a comprehensive understanding of collision dynamics. Accurate use of these techniques and tools is vital for establishing fault and assessing liability in pedestrian accident claims.

Factors That Influence the Accuracy of Accident Reconstruction

The accuracy of accident reconstruction is significantly influenced by the quality and completeness of evidence collected at the scene. Precise measurements, eyewitness testimonies, and physical evidence such as skid marks or vehicle debris are critical components. Any gaps or inaccuracies in this evidence can compromise reconstruction results.

Environmental conditions during the incident also play a vital role. Factors such as weather, lighting, and road conditions can alter the dynamics of a pedestrian accident, affecting the interpretation of events. Poor visibility or wet surfaces, for example, might lead to different reconstruction outcomes.

Additionally, technological limitations and the expertise of the accident reconstruction expert impact the reliability of findings. Advanced tools like laser scanners or simulation software provide more precise data. However, improper use or interpretation of such tools can decrease the accuracy of the reconstruction.

Challenges Faced by Experts in Pedestrian Accident Cases

Accident reconstruction experts face several challenges when investigating pedestrian accident cases. One primary challenge is obtaining high-quality evidence promptly, as post-accident scenes can be quickly altered or obscured. Any delay hampers the accuracy of the reconstruction process.

Environmental conditions also pose difficulties, such as poor lighting, weather effects, or obstructed views, which can compromise data clarity. These factors hinder precise analysis and may lead to less reliable reconstructions. Additionally, conflicting witness testimonies can complicate the determination of causality and fault.

Limited access to certain accident scene details, like surveillance footage or physical evidence, can further restrict expert analysis. Technical limitations and evolving reconstruction tools demand continuous adaptation. These challenges underscore the importance of meticulous evidence collection and expert proficiency in navigating complex pedestrian accident cases.

Advancements Enhancing the Role of Accident Reconstruction Experts

Technological advancements have significantly enhanced the capabilities of accident reconstruction experts, leading to more precise and reliable analyses in pedestrian accident claims. Innovations such as high-resolution laser scanning and 3D modeling enable experts to recreate accident scenes with remarkable accuracy. These tools provide detailed visualizations that can highlight crucial facts often missed through traditional methods.

Furthermore, data collection instruments like drone technology and advanced photogrammetry facilitate comprehensive scene documentation, even in challenging or inaccessible areas. This improved data collection improves the quality of evidence, leading to more accurate fault determination and liability assessments.

Emerging analytical software allows experts to simulate various collision scenarios, accounting for environmental factors and vehicle dynamics. These simulations help clarify complex accident sequences, bolstering the credibility of expert testimony in court proceedings. Overall, technological progress continues to refine the role of accident reconstruction experts, positively impacting pedestrian accident claims outcomes.
